On 12/21/20 11:20, George Edwards wrote:
Hello,
I have three signals routed to the Gnuradio Polyphase Channelizer
Block. The system operates at a sample rate of 90 kHz with 3 channels
spaced 25 kHz apart. One channel is centered around DC and the other
two at +/-25 kHz. The 3 waveforms are routed into a Gnuradio Streams
to Stream Block, so that a simple concatenated stream flows into the
Gnuradio Polyphase Channelizer. I also set the Channelizer Block to
use 120 Taps and provide 3-outputs. Here are my questions on observing
the outputs
Q1. I was expecting each output (block set to 3 outputs) to be at the
sample rate (90 kHz/3 =) 30 kz in each of the 3-plots. The plots show
a sample rate based on the original rate of 90 kHz. Why is this?
Q2. I expected each output waveform to be centered around DC, but they
were instead centered around -25 kHz. Why?
Q3. The output bandwidth for each waveform seems a little bigger than
the input, why?
